Fatty acid amide hydrolase deficiency enhances intraplaque neutrophil recruitment in atherosclerotic mice.
Arteriosclerosis, thrombosis, and vascular biology - 1 Feb 2013
Lenglet Sébastien, Thomas Aurélien, Soehnlein Oliver, Montecucco Fabrizio, Burger Fabienne, Pelli Graziano, Galan Katia, Cravatt Benjamin, Staub Christian, Steffens Sabine
Abstract excerpt
OBJECTIVE: Endocannabinoid levels are elevated in human and mouse atherosclerosis, but their causal role is not well understood. Therefore, we studied the involvement of fatty acid amide hydrolase (FAAH) deficiency, the major enzyme responsible for endocannabinoid anandamide degradation, in atherosclerotic plaque vulnerability.
